TORONTO, May 27, 2022 — Base Carbon Inc. (NEO:BCBN) (OTCQX:BCBNF) ( “Base Carbon ”, or the “ Company ”) is pleased to announce it has executed an agreement, through Base Carbon Capital Partners Corp. (“ Base Carbon Capital ”), to facilitate the development of a cookstove and water purifier carbon reduction project in Vietnam (the “ Project ”) with Sustainability Investment Promotion and Development Joint Stock Company (“ SIPCO ”), as in-country project developer. Citigroup Global Markets Limited (“ Citigroup ”) is the carbon credit offtaker to SIPCO for the Project.

The Project is expected to generate approximately 26.6 million voluntary carbon credits over an estimated 10-year period from the distribution of approximately 850,000 cookstoves and 364,000 water purifiers to participating households in Vietnam. Cookstoves improve household energy efficiency through a reduction in combustible biomass needed for daily household activities such as cooking and heating, while water purifiers can eliminate the need to boil water for safe consumption. Both types of devices are recognized under well-established carbon reduction methodologies with additional and far-reaching social benefits. The Project has been registered with Verra’s VCS program under Project IDs 2548 and 2557 .

Base Carbon Capital will advance an aggregate purchase price prepayment for Project carbon credits of approximately US$20.8 million in regular payment tranches anticipated over the next 24 months. Pursuant to the terms of the Project agreement with SIPCO, the advanced purchase price payment will primarily finance the manufacturing and distribution of the cookstoves and water purifiers as well as certain costs related to initial distribution and Project monitoring. Each prepayment will be conditional upon key development milestones and conditions such as the delivery and distribution of devices to participating households.

Based on Project documentation, SIPCO will buy back the first 7.4 million carbon credits from the Project for offtake. Further to this, approximately 19.2 million additional carbon credits are expected to be generated which may be sold by Base Carbon Capital to either SIPCO, pursuant to an option agreement, or into the open voluntary carbon credit market (or a combination thereof).

Based on Project documentation with SIPCO and carbon credit generation projections, Base Carbon Capital expects to achieve a 2.75-year payback on aggregate capital deployed and, based on an illustrative sale price of US$10.00 per carbon credit for the anticipated 19.2 million additional credits, Base Carbon Capital’s attributable Project NPV* is estimated to be US$78.6 million in aggregate with an IRR* of 66%. For clarity, a carbon credit sale price of US$10.00 is only illustrative, and the price that the carbon credits on the market may be higher or lower at the time of sale.

About Sustainability Investment Promotion and Development Joint Stock Company (SIPCO)

SIPCO was founded in 2019 and is primarily focused on establishing a highly competitive carbon portfolio under the direction of the board of directors of Investment and Trade Consultancy Company Limited (“INTRACO”). INTRACO, owner and managing director of SIPCO, was founded in 2001 as an environmental and safety management consulting firm and has been focusing on clean development mechanism (CDM) carbon credit projects since 2007.  INTRACO has grown into a specialised, experienced, and market-leading firm in the consultation and development of CDM projects in Vietnam, with 113 CDM projects and 8 programs of activities (POAs) completed too far. INTRACO’s portfolio includes projects in nearly every CDM sector, including oil and gas, renewable energy, biogas, biomass, energy efficiency, and fuel switching. INTRACO carries out programmes that provide people with energy-efficient cookstoves, clean drinking water, and renewable electricity in partnership with many well-known institutional clients.
